The T70A is an auditorium guitar from Lâg. Lâg is a French company that markets good guitars for a small price. The T70A is part of Lâg's Tramontane series. Within this series they try to produce popular guitar models with French guitar building techniques. As a result, the guitars are very unique and striking. This can be seen, for example, in the rosette or the tuning pegs, which clearly show that this is a Lâg guitar. This is an auditorium model from the series. Auditorium guitars are the most versatile acoustic guitars. The auditorium falls between the dreadnought and the grand concert, both in terms of size and performance options. Dreadnoughts are the ideal rhythm guitar, although grand concert guitars are mainly used for fingerpicking. So both can be very well applied to the auditorium. The top of the sound box is made of spruce wood, which produces a warm sound. The back and sides are made of sapele, which offers great resonance and a clear sound. The Yamaha B1's Keyboard and mechanics
All keyboards used by Yamaha in their acoustic pianos are produced in-house. The B-series keyboards are made of Sitka spruce. In order to deliver optimal keyboards, the wood is dried carefully and in a natural way. This drying process sometimes takes up to 2 years. After this time, the keys are acclimatized in very hot kilns. The keys are then not coated, so that the benefit of this drying procedure is optimal. The keys can then no longer be influenced by conditions such as temperature and humidity and thus remain in absolute top condition for many years.
Yamaha uses a patented technology for drying and gluing maple wood in the B1. This type of wood is most commonly used for piano mechanisms and ensures a very accurate and durable action. The patented drying and gluing technology ensures that the mechanism can withstand continuous shocking, as well as changes in temperature and humidity. The mechanism consists of no fewer than 5500 parts, all of which are produced by Yamaha itself. One of the most unique parts is the aluminum rails that keep the deviation in the attachment point to a minimum. Yamaha was the first company to use Aluminium, which is insensitive to temperature changes.
Other models in the B-Series
The "B-series pianos" from Yamaha consists of three models, in addition to this B1 model, the 113 centimeter high Yamaha B2 and the 121 centimeter high Yamaha B3 are also available. As the series progresses, the pianos not only get higher, but also use more quality features such as a solid soundboard and extra support beams.
Silent Version
There may be times when you would like to play the acoustic piano but find yourself unable to play at specific times because of the sound. Then the Yamaha B1 Silent Piano is an option. A Silent System then allows you to play a real acoustic piano, without noise pollution. The Silent System ensures that the sounds are reproduced through your headphones.

The keyboard and mechanism of the Yamaha B1
When you purchase a Yamaha B1 piano, you are purchasing a piano of Japanese quality. Although assembly is outsourced to factories in Indonesia, this does not compromise the quality. Yamaha's expertise in acoustic pianos, combined with their many years of experience, makes them a very stable player in the piano world, praised for their pleasant, clear sounds. This is partly achieved through the high-quality components made from the best materials. For example, all keyboards are produced in-house from Sitka spruce wood. This wood is dried for six to 24 months and then further acclimatised in computer-controlled ovens. This treatment ensures that the keys are hardly affected by changes in temperature and humidity.
The piano mechanism is also resistant to these conditions thanks to specially developed technologies for drying and gluing maple. The use of aluminium parts also makes the mechanism very stable. In total, the action consists of 5,500 parts, each of which is developed by Yamaha itself. These actions are developed with incredible accuracy. The precision of the holes drilled in the caps is even achieved with an accuracy of 0.05 millimetres. It is therefore not surprising that a Yamaha B1 plays so smoothly!

Transacoustic
The third generation of Transacoustic pianos combines the worlds of acoustic and digital pianos like never before. Fundamentally an acoustic piano, it can of course be played entirely acoustically, allowing you to fully enjoy the pure, rich sounds of Yamaha’s high-quality instruments. In addition, the piano is equipped with a range of digital features, allowing it to operate in Silent and Hybrid modes.
Hybrid Mode
In Hybrid mode, a Transacoustic piano combines digital sounds with the acoustic elements of the instrument. It allows you both to acoustically mute the piano so that the hammers no longer strike the strings, and to use the piano acoustically to enhance the digital sounds. The digital system uses enhanced foundational sounds derived from the world-famous Yamaha CFX concert grand and the legendary Bösendorfer Imperial grand, each key meticulously recorded at very high quality. These recordings have been processed into the latest samples, which are brought to life by the Transacoustic system through specially designed transducers.
When the acoustic sound is dampened, this system is truly unique because the digital sound is still enhanced by acoustic elements such as the vibration of the soundboard and string resonances. This allows you to play the piano at a lower volume while retaining a lifelike tonal character. For example, you can also play other sounds like a Fender Rhodes with the enhancement of the acoustic elements, resulting in really exciting combinations. Another great option is to play purely acoustically, where the piano is not dampened and can be digitally augmented with, for example, a string orchestra.
Silent Mode
With a Yamaha Transacoustic, you can also play in Silent mode. The acoustic part is muted, and the digital sound can be played through headphones. This is ideal, for example, when one family member wants to watch TV while another wants to play the piano. When wearing headphones, you are fully immersed in the piano thanks to binaural technology. This technology ensures the experience is exactly like sitting at the piano and is therefore incomparable to the usual left-right headphone sound. You can play for hours and enjoy yourself at the piano without disturbing anyone — that’s possible with a Transacoustic!
Touch and Feel
The touch and feel of the Transacoustic is breathtaking in every mode. For the first time, all sensors are completely contactless, so the digital technology has no negative impact on the acoustic playing experience of the piano. Acoustically, it remains truly acoustic without compromise. In Silent mode, the feel of the acoustic action remains, except that the hammer no longer physically strikes the string. The technology is designed so that stopping the hammer happens very subtly, making it unnoticeable to the player. The digital sound is generated by digital sensors, which for the first time are placed under the keys, near the hammers, and at the pedals. This allows for even more precise detection of your playing, enabling greater expressiveness.
App
For the first time, the third generation Transacoustic can wirelessly connect to your smart device via Bluetooth MIDI. The comprehensive Smart Pianist app offers many options for selecting and editing sounds. In addition to Bluetooth MIDI, the piano also supports Bluetooth audio, allowing you to stream music wirelessly through the piano. Thanks to its special transducers, the Transacoustic piano can be used as a high-quality speaker for listening to music

An important element of the B2 piano is that, like the B3, it has a soundboard made of solid spruce. This spruce comes from North America where the temperatures and altitude are ideal for growing high quality spruce. Once the wood has been grown, it is transported to the Yamaha factory in Kitami, Japan. This factory, specialized in woodworking processes, then manufactures the high-quality soundboards.
More information about the B Series
The Yamaha B2 is the middle model of three pianos. With a height of 113 cm, this piano has a solid sound box that ensures a warm, powerful sound. The higher the body of a piano, the longer the strings become and the larger the soundboard becomes. This has a positive effect on the sound, but must be tuned to the room in which the piano will be placed. The 300 series contains versatile guitars. There are two options within the series: guitars made of sapele and spruce and guitars made of blackwood and mahogany. All steel string guitars in the series have V-Class bracing, which will produce a louder volume and a longer sustain. Furthermore, the series has a large selection of guitar shapes and also 12-string and classical guitars. This makes the series very utilitarian.
The 354ce is a great twelve-string guitar. The body has a spruce top and sapele back and sides. This produces a warm and powerful sound. The guitar has a mahogany neck and an ebony fretboard. The guitar has a Grand Auditorium body, which was designed by Taylor in 1994 and is their most popular model. The Grand Auditorium is a bit smaller than the Dreadnought and a bit bigger than the Grand Concert. This also makes it more versatile, as the Dreadnought was designed for rhythm guitar and the Grand Concert for fingerpicking. The Grand Auditorium is a combination of both. The guitar has ES2 electronics so the amplified sound will sound authentic.
Taylor is an American company that was founded in 1974 when two boys bought an old hippie guitar shop. The boys were very passionate about guitars and put a lot of energy into the shop. Eventually, the shop evolved into an international company. All Taylor guitars today are made in either El Cajon in California or Tecate in Mexico. Taylor is very proud of this, because guitars that are produced close to headquarters go through a more thorough quality control process and employee satisfaction is better regulated. Taylor prioritises tone and comfort. All guitars are perfected and with modern luthier techniques the guitars can be made with more precision and consistency.

The 400 series contains utilitarian guitars for different purposes. The series includes several different models with solid Indian rosewood back and sides and solid spruce tops. This is an amazing combination of tonewoods as it produces warm low-end and clear trebles. The mid-tones are more neutral which makes the guitar very suitable to sing along with. The guitars have V-Class bracing, which means that the volume is louder and that it has a longer sustain.
